Output 635275844bfb088e3fcda7f9f3015dbf7ae688ec80d92e59245cca72fc66d74d:8

value
2355251885
script pubkey
OP_0 OP_PUSHBYTES_20 18ba5edf31c74497d3a894034f3bbeee29dcb4a5
address
bc1qrza9ahe3cazf05agjsp57wa7ac5aed99gtxl2g
transaction
635275844bfb088e3fcda7f9f3015dbf7ae688ec80d92e59245cca72fc66d74d